Two lorries collide on A1 causing heavy traffic in Stamford
Traffic has cleared following a crash between two lorries on the A1 near Stamford.
Police were called to the collision near Water Newton at about 5.50am.
Two lorries were damaged in the crash and the southbound carriageway was completely blocked, leaving traffic queueing back as far as Stamford.
No-one was hurt in the collision. Police have cleared the road and traffic is now moving normally.
